English speaking people in Ireland refer to the Prime Minister by the Irish language title of Taoiseach when speaking English. Same with our police force which are gardaí (or colloquially "guards") and the Oireachtas for parliament. ...

The Taoiseach is the head of government, or prime minister, of Ireland. The office is appointed by the president of Ireland upon the nomination of Dáil Éireann (the lower house of the Oireachtas, Ireland's national legislature) and the office-holder must retain the support of a majority in the Dáil to remain in office. The Irish word taoiseach means "chief" or "leader", and was adopted in the 1937 Constitution …
